I know!! Another upma recipe. I'm trying to diversify the breakfast palette, but I just can't help it. This is basically just Bataka Puva minus the bataka.
2 cups puva (beaten rice)
1 chopped onion
3 chopped green chillies
1/4 tsp mustard seeds
Pinch of turmeric
Salt to taste
1 tsp sugar
2 tsp lemon juice
2 tsp peanuts
1 tbsp chopped cilantro for garnish
grated coconut for garnish
1 tbsp oil
1. Soak puva in water for 5 minutes. Drain water completely and set aside.
2. Heat oil in pan and add mustard seeds and peanuts. Then add onions and sautee until golden brown.
3. Next add salt, green chillies, and turmeric and fry for 2 minutes.
4. Add the soaked puva and sugar and stir together well. Simmer for 2-3 minutes.
5. Finally, garnish with lemon juice, chopped cilantro, and shredded coconut.
